uni-app显示层次
时间: 2023-08-05 21:04:42 浏览: 66
Uni-app 是一个基于 Vue.js 的跨平台应用开发框架,它可以同时开发运行在多个平台(包括 H5、iOS、Android 等)的应用程序。在 Uni-app 中,应用的显示层次可以通过 Vue 组件的嵌套关系来实现。
Uni-app 的显示层次可以分为以下几个层次:
1. 应用层:整个 Uni-app 应用程序的最外层,包含了所有页面和组件。
2. 页面层:应用程序中的每个页面都是一个独立的页面层,可以通过路由进行切换。
3. 组件层:页面中的具体内容一般由多个组件组成,组件可以嵌套使用,形成组件层次。
4. 元素层:组件内部可以包含多个元素层,元素层是最小的显示单元,可以是 HTML 元素或者其他组件。
通过这样的层次结构,Uni-app 可以实现复杂的页面布局和交互效果。开发者可以通过编写 Vue 组件来定义页面和组件,并通过路由配置来管理页面之间的切换。同时,Uni-app 还提供了丰富的组件库和 API,方便开发者进行快速开发。
相关问题
uni-app 显示进度
uni-app提供了一个名为uni-progress的组件来显示进度。该组件可以通过设置百分比值或者进度条的长度来显示进度。同时,该组件还支持自定义颜色、高度、形状等属性,以满足不同场景下的需求。除此之外,uni-app还提供了一些其他的组件和API来帮助开发者实现更加丰富的进度显示效果,例如loading组件、toast组件等。总的来说,uni-app提供了丰富的工具和组件来帮助开发者实现各种进度显示效果,开发者可以根据自己的需求选择合适的组件和API来使用。
uni-app显示隐藏
要在uni-app中实现显示隐藏,可以使用v-show或v-if指令。v-show会在元素上设置display属性,而v-if会在DOM树中添加或删除元素。具体使用哪个指令取决于你的需求和性能考虑。
例如,如果你需要频繁切换元素的显示状态,使用v-show可能更好,因为它只是改变CSS属性而不会重新渲染DOM。但是,如果你需要在条件满足时添加或删除元素,使用v-if可能更好,因为它可以减少DOM树的大小。
相关推荐
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![pptx](https://img-home.csdnimg.cn/images/20210720083543.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)